About Montgomery County, Texas
Montgomery County, Texas has a total population of 684,432, making it the 98th most populous county in the United States. The median age in Montgomery County is 37.2 years, which is 4.4% below the national median of 38.9 years.
The median household income in Montgomery County is $97,701, which ranks #186 of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 30.0% above the national median of $75,149. The poverty rate is 9.4%, lower than the national rate of 12.6%. The unemployment rate stands at 4.5%.
The median home value in Montgomery County is $346,200, 22.8% above the national median. Renters in Montgomery County pay a median gross rent of $1,532 per month. The homeownership rate is 71.8%, compared to the national rate of 64.4%.
In Montgomery County, 38.8%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her, 15.1% above the national average of 33.7%. Health insurance coverage stands at 84.9% of the population. The average commute time for workers is 35.2 min.
Montgomery County is a diverse community. The largest racial or ethnic group is White (non-Hispanic) at 58.7% of the population, followed by Hispanic or Latino (27.9%) and Black (non-Hispanic) (6.1%).
All data for Montgomery County, Texas com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ates.
